## Authentication

Heads up: the nightly reindex job (`reindex_nightly.py`) talks to the Lanternfish search cluster, and that cluster won't accept anonymous writes anymore — we locked it down last sprint. The job now authenticates as the `reindex-runner` service identity against Corvid Gateway, and the token is injected via the `LF_INDEX_TOKEN` env var in the scheduler config. Nothing clever going on, just a bearer header on every batch request. For review purposes, the staging credential currently in use is listed below.

service key, kadug-kadup: kto15_rN23XLAYImmZgrJ

## Local Setup: Config Hot-Reloading

Veltrix watches the `conf/` directory and reloads settings without a restart. After cloning the repo, run `veltrix dev --watch` and edit any YAML file; changes apply within two seconds. Note that logging levels and feature flags reload cleanly, but connection pools are rebuilt, so expect a brief pause. If a reload fails validation, the previous config stays active. To connect the watcher to the staging database, use the following connection string.

replica DSN, kajep-yahag: mssql://praok_svc:iF@db-8d68.plorvaio.local:5432/eliion

Subject: Timebell cut-over summary

Team — the Timebell timetable solver cut over to the new constraint engine on Tuesday night as planned. All three pilot schools resolved their schedules within the target window, and the legacy solver is now read-only. One hiccup: room-capacity constraints needed a re-tune mid-cutover, handled by the Ashgrove crew. Legacy decommission is scheduled for month end. For reference, the production settings we landed on are below.

deployment values, kajep-kageg:
[praix]
host = praix.paliqcorp.corp
user = praix_svc
database = praix_prod